What is Oocyte Donation and Who Needs It?

Oocyte donation is a fertility treatment where a healthy egg from a donor is fertilized with the recipient’s partner’s sperm (or donor sperm) and then implanted into the recipient’s uterus. This allows women who cannot produce viable eggs to experience pregnancy and childbirth.

Who Should Consider Oocyte Donation?

βœ” Women with premature ovarian failure (early menopause)

βœ” Women with poor egg quality due to age (over 40 years)

βœ” Women with genetic disorders that could be passed to the child

βœ” Women who have undergone chemotherapy or radiation affecting ovarian function

βœ” Couples who have had repeated IVF failures due to egg quality issues

πŸ’‘ Egg donation allows you to experience pregnancy and childbirth, even if your own eggs are not viable.

Step-by-Step Oocyte Donation Process

1. Selecting an Egg Donor

βœ” Donors undergo thorough medical, genetic, and psychological screening.
βœ” Donors are typically young women (under 30) with high ovarian reserve.
βœ” The recipient can choose an anonymous or known donor.

2. Synchronizing the Recipient’s Cycle

βœ” The recipient’s menstrual cycle is synchronized with the donor using hormonal medications.
βœ” The recipient takes estrogen and progesterone to prepare the uterus for embryo implantation.

3. Egg Retrieval from the Donor & Fertilization

βœ” The donor undergoes ovarian stimulation and egg retrieval (same as IVF).
βœ” Retrieved eggs are fertilized with the partner’s sperm (or donor sperm) in the lab.
βœ” The resulting embryos are monitored for 3-5 days to ensure healthy development.

4. Embryo Transfer into the Recipient’s Uterus

βœ” A high-quality embryo is selected and transferred into the recipient’s uterus.
βœ” The recipient continues progesterone and estrogen medications to support implantation.
βœ” A pregnancy test is done 12-14 days later to confirm success.

πŸ’‘ Excess embryos can be frozen for future attempts (Frozen Embryo Transfer – FET).

What Do Studies Show?

Oocyte donation has some of the highest IVF success rates, as donor eggs come from young, healthy women.

βœ” Pregnancy rate per cycle: 55-70%
βœ” Live birth rate per cycle: 50-60%
βœ” Higher success than traditional IVF for women over 40

πŸ’‘ Success rates depend on the recipient’s uterine health and overall medical condition.
